Our dice roller has the following features:
- If there is "resource" in the reason, it shows a down arrow (🔻) when a unit has been consumed and the die should be reduced. An empty square (⬜) means everything remains as it is. See the rolls for water, food and torches below.
- In some situations, the players and GM will actually roll for a number. A chalice worth 3d4 copper pieces, a 2d6 roll in a random weather table, etc. If that's the case, the total result is what is relevant and the symbols should be ignored.
- For everything else, we assume they are part of a skill test and add the skulls (☠️) and swords (⚔️) as appropriate. The total number should be ignored.
